BROOKLYN Beckham's eight-minute cooking show costs a staggering £74,000 an episode to make. Cookin' With Brooklyn sees the aspiring chef, 22, rustle up some of his favourite dishes on Facebook Messenger's streaming service Watch Together.
Dishes include a bagel stacked with hash browns, tortilla wraps and juicy steaks. His Facebook show reportedly has a crew of 62 people working on it including a culinary producer, five cameramen and another nine producers.
A source told the New York Post: "It's unheard of. It's the sort of crewing you would expect on a big TV show." The photographer has no formal training when it comes to cooking, but Gordon Ramsay is a family friend who has taught dad David many tricks over the years.
And part of his show sees him receive lessons from world famous chefs like Nobu Matsuhisa - the mastermind behind the Japanese restaurant Nobu.
